Which seafood cannot be fed to cats?

For example, tuna itself contains a large amount of polyunsaturated fatty acids and requires a considerable amount of vitamin E to prevent fatty acids from defeat. If cats eat a diet containing excessive amounts of tuna for a long time, they may develop yellow fat disease. The cause of this disease is that the content of vitamin E in the food is insufficient, forming a yellow substance that is deposited in the body fat. The disease will produce a painful inflammatory response. The key to preventing this disease in cats is to feed them a nutritionally complete and balanced diet while avoiding excessive tuna.

Converting from kitten food to adult cat food

When a cat reaches one year old, it needs to switch to adult cat food specially formulated for adult cats; Adult cats no longer need the large amounts of energy and nutrients provided by kitten food. Remember to follow the same rule when changing pet food: gradually mix it in over 5-7 days. During this period of changing food, special attention should be paid to monitoring the cat's weight and adjusting the feeding amount according to the cat's weight at any time. Most cats will eat a certain amount of food based on the heat energy they need, so they can be fed by the ad libitum method. However, if the cat only moves indoors, the amount of activity is not large, so the free-feeding method may cause overweight problems; therefore, quantitative feeding twice a day can be used to prevent the cat from becoming overweight.

Nutrients needed by kittens

If the cat’s food lacks sufficient taurine (an essential amino acid for cats, only found in animal meat), it will cause problems such as growth retardation, blindness, heart disease, and reproductive disorders. Kittens and adult cats must have plenty of fresh and clean drinking water at all times.
